Abstract

The application of fiqih jinayah in Aceh is the implementation of Islamic criminal law regulated in Qanun Jinayat as part of the implementation of Islamic law in the region. This is based on the special authority granted by Law Number 11/2006 on the Government of Aceh. Qanun Jinayat includes various criminal provisions such as hudud, qisas, and ta'zir that regulate certain offenses, including zina, gambling, alcohol consumption, and khalwat. Punishments include flogging, fines, and imprisonment. However, the implementation of fiqh jinayah in Aceh faces various challenges, such as resistance from certain groups, limited public understanding, and issues of compatibility with human rights principles. On the other hand, this implementation is considered successful in reducing the level of certain crimes and strengthening the Islamic identity of the people of Aceh. Thus, fiqih jinayah in Aceh is an example of how Islamic law can be integrated into the national legal system, although it requires evaluation and adaptation to ensure its implementation is fair, transparent, and in accordance with the social context of the community.

Abstract

Zakat, sebagai salah satu pilar penting dalam Islam, memiliki potensi besar untuk menjadi instrumen pengentasan kemiskinan dan penggerak kesejahteraan umat. Artikel ini bertujuan untuk mengeksplorasi pentingnya pengelolaan zakat produktif dalam meningkatkan kesejahteraan umat. Tinjauan pustaka akan membahas konsep zakat, peran zakat produktif dalam ekonomi Islam, serta praktik pengelolaan zakat produktif di beberapa negara. Metodologi artikel ini melibatkan studi pustaka dan analisis data sekunder. Hasil penelitian menunjukkan bahwa pengelolaan zakat produktif dapat menjadi solusi efektif dalam menggerakkan roda kesejahteraan umat, dengan memberikan pendekatan yang berkelanjutan dan berdaya tahan. Pembahasan akan menguraikan implikasi temuan ini dalam konteks sosial, ekonomi, dan kebijakan. Kesimpulan artikel ini menyimpulkan pentingnya peran zakat produktif dalam mendukung pembangunan ekonomi umat dan menawarkan arahan untuk pengembangan lebih lanjut dalam pengelolaan zakat produktif.

Abstract

The aim of this research is to discuss the opinion that treatment with haram objects from an Islamic perspective causes controversy and debate. This article discusses how Islam views the use of haram objects in medicine and whether this is permissible or not. Based on several hadiths of the Prophet Muhammad, Islam places great emphasis on the importance of health and medical treatment, but also prioritizes halal principles and does not allow the use of haram objects as medicine. This article also discusses several different opinions of Islamic scholars in interpreting the law on the use of haram objects in medicine. In synthesis, this article shows that the use of haram objects in medicine is not permitted in Islam and that health must be achieved by means that are halal and in accordance with religious principles.
